I have a Tandberg 820 Ultrium 3 tape drive which works just fine under windows and using ntbackup. It has the firmware specified by EMC and the latest retrospect drivers. The device is simply not detected. I had considered this solution since it was more cost effective than Backup Exec. Anyone have any ideas how I can get this to work. EMC won't support me since I am running the trial software. Thanks in advance.

Windows is not reporting any storage devices to Retrospect, not even the internal hard disks or CD drives.

 

Have you restarted the computer?

 

You may want to try and update the SCSI card drivers to the latest version. Windows 2000 may be using old SCSI card drivers, and updated drivers may help locate the device.

I don't have a clue what things should look like. The SCSI controller has the latest firmware, bios, and drivers. The 820 is the only SCSI device. I am looking at Retro to replace Backup Exec since it is an older version and doesn't have the the tape drivers for the 820. The hard drives are all SATA devices. Backup Exec runs fine on this machine.

You were, of course, correct. After I uninstalled Backup Exec all the devices were visible. Now I am working through learning a totally new interface.
